Assigned dining is in a separate dining area than anytime dining. You are not away from the main part of the dining room- you are in a different dining room, or a different floor.

However, I've never noticed that one dining room on a ship is better than the other. They generally look pretty much the same, although one may be two story and one one story. The place settings will be the same, the food comes from the same kitchen. On the Magic last week, assigned dining was on the 2nd story of the midship dining room, or in the aft dining room. Anytime was on the first story of the midship dining room.

 

The service will vary depending on your waiters. We've been on assigned dining that was super fast and SUPER slow; but we've been in anytime dining that was super fast and super slow too... you just never know.

 

I think you can be happy with your dining choice. You are not relegated to second class by any means.
